Performance Profile
Performance Profiles are used to create network performance threshold policies for BSSs and wireless
clients on your wireless LAN. When a Performance Profile is applied to your system, a performance
alarm is generated if the performance thresholds for that profile are exceeded. If there are no
Performance Profiles applied to your system, no performance alarms are generated.
Note
You should monitor new ADSP deployments for several weeks to determine normal network
activity before configuring Performance Profiles.
Performance Profiles are managed from the Performance Profile screen.
